ATilt Rope Weight[Japanese title] is an object which debuted inKirby: Triple Deluxe. It consists of an eight ton weight attached to a rope, similar to aString Platform, though it is also attached to a slider and can be re-positioned when the playertilts theNintendo 3DS system. A variant of this object also appears inKirby: Planet Robobot, though it is held up by a chain instead.
These objects appear in side-chambers in many stages. When Kirby cuts the string using aCopy Ability capable of doing so (such asSword orSpear), the weight falls, crashing through any breakable blocks below. The weight can destroy aCrystalline Block if it lands on top, but will simply break if it hits hard ground or aGate. A Tilt Rope Weight will reset if Kirby leaves the room and comes back.
